3.12.
Operating the DNL910 and
DNL920
This section explains how to operate the DNL910 and
DNL920 loggers and provides an overview of the menu
options on the units' LCD screen.

3.12.1. Turning on the Unit

In order to view the logger menu options, the unit must be
powered on by pressing the Scroll button
Ensure the logger is charged or connected to the AC adapter.
Once the unit is switched on it will emit a short beep and the
screen will display a welcome message:
Fourier Systems
Logger

3.12.2. Display Shutdown

If the logger screen is inactive for thirty seconds it will turn off.
